Kai Pelayo of Bayer (and an MEO board member) delivered more than 160 pumpkins on Friday from Kula Country Farms to the MEO Head Start office in Wailuku for distribution to Head Start sites on Maui. Pumpkins also were delivered to the Moloka‘i Head Start site. Each preschooler and some MEO staff got a pumpkin to get into the spirit of Halloween on Tuesday.
